Research and Applied Perspective to Blockchain Technology: A Comprehensive Survey

Blockchain being a leading technology in the 21st century is revolutionizing each sector of life. Services are being provided and upgraded using its salient features and fruitful characteristics. Businesses are being enhanced by using this technology. Countries are shifting towards digital currencie...

Full description

Bibliographic Details
Main Authors: Sumaira Johar, Naveed Ahmad, Warda Asher, Haitham Cruickshank, Amad Durrani
Format: Article
Language:English
Published: MDPI AG 2021-07-01
Series:Applied Sciences
Subjects:
Online Access:https://www.mdpi.com/2076-3417/11/14/6252
_version_ 1827688030029217792
author Sumaira Johar
Naveed Ahmad
Warda Asher
Haitham Cruickshank
Amad Durrani
author_facet Sumaira Johar
Naveed Ahmad
Warda Asher
Haitham Cruickshank
Amad Durrani
author_sort Sumaira Johar
collection DOAJ
description Blockchain being a leading technology in the 21st century is revolutionizing each sector of life. Services are being provided and upgraded using its salient features and fruitful characteristics. Businesses are being enhanced by using this technology. Countries are shifting towards digital currencies i.e., an initial application of blockchain application. It omits the need of central authority by its distributed ledger functionality. This distributed ledger is achieved by using a consensus mechanism in blockchain. A consensus algorithm plays a core role in the implementation of blockchain. Any application implementing blockchain uses consensus algorithms to achieve its desired task. In this paper, we focus on provisioning of a comparative analysis of blockchain’s consensus algorithms with respect to the type of application. Furthermore, we discuss the development platforms as well as technologies of blockchain. The aim of the paper is to provide knowledge from basic to extensive from blockchain architecture to consensus methods, from applications to development platform, from challenges and issues to blockchain research gaps in various areas.
first_indexed 2024-03-10T09:47:15Z
format Article
id doaj.art-b67d490d744248629940e848907300a0
institution Directory Open Access Journal
issn 2076-3417
language English
last_indexed 2024-03-10T09:47:15Z
publishDate 2021-07-01
publisher MDPI AG
record_format Article
series Applied Sciences
spelling doaj.art-b67d490d744248629940e848907300a02023-11-22T03:06:46ZengMDPI AGApplied Sciences2076-34172021-07-011114625210.3390/app11146252Research and Applied Perspective to Blockchain Technology: A Comprehensive SurveySumaira Johar0Naveed Ahmad1Warda Asher2Haitham Cruickshank3Amad Durrani4Department of Computer Science, University of Peshawar, Peshawar 25000, PakistanDepartment of Computer Science, University of Peshawar, Peshawar 25000, PakistanDepartment of Computer Science, University of Peshawar, Peshawar 25000, PakistanInstitute of Communication Systems, University of Surrey, Guildford GU2 7JP, UKDepartment of Computer Science, University of Peshawar, Peshawar 25000, PakistanBlockchain being a leading technology in the 21st century is revolutionizing each sector of life. Services are being provided and upgraded using its salient features and fruitful characteristics. Businesses are being enhanced by using this technology. Countries are shifting towards digital currencies i.e., an initial application of blockchain application. It omits the need of central authority by its distributed ledger functionality. This distributed ledger is achieved by using a consensus mechanism in blockchain. A consensus algorithm plays a core role in the implementation of blockchain. Any application implementing blockchain uses consensus algorithms to achieve its desired task. In this paper, we focus on provisioning of a comparative analysis of blockchain’s consensus algorithms with respect to the type of application. Furthermore, we discuss the development platforms as well as technologies of blockchain. The aim of the paper is to provide knowledge from basic to extensive from blockchain architecture to consensus methods, from applications to development platform, from challenges and issues to blockchain research gaps in various areas.https://www.mdpi.com/2076-3417/11/14/6252blockchainapplicationsconsensus mechanisms
spellingShingle Sumaira Johar
Naveed Ahmad
Warda Asher
Haitham Cruickshank
Amad Durrani
Research and Applied Perspective to Blockchain Technology: A Comprehensive Survey
Applied Sciences
blockchain
applications
consensus mechanisms
title Research and Applied Perspective to Blockchain Technology: A Comprehensive Survey
title_full Research and Applied Perspective to Blockchain Technology: A Comprehensive Survey
title_fullStr Research and Applied Perspective to Blockchain Technology: A Comprehensive Survey
title_full_unstemmed Research and Applied Perspective to Blockchain Technology: A Comprehensive Survey
title_short Research and Applied Perspective to Blockchain Technology: A Comprehensive Survey
title_sort research and applied perspective to blockchain technology a comprehensive survey
topic blockchain
applications
consensus mechanisms
url https://www.mdpi.com/2076-3417/11/14/6252
work_keys_str_mv AT sumairajohar researchandappliedperspectivetoblockchaintechnologyacomprehensivesurvey
AT naveedahmad researchandappliedperspectivetoblockchaintechnologyacomprehensivesurvey
AT wardaasher researchandappliedperspectivetoblockchaintechnologyacomprehensivesurvey
AT haithamcruickshank researchandappliedperspectivetoblockchaintechnologyacomprehensivesurvey
AT amaddurrani researchandappliedperspectivetoblockchaintechnologyacomprehensivesurvey